Emmons Arreted for Maintaining a Common Nuisance
01/23/13 On Monday, January 21st at 8:37 AM, the Plymouth Police Department executed a search warrant at 822 West Monroe Street. City officers were assisted by the Indiana State Police and Marshall County Sheriff’s Department. The warrant was obtained after complaints were received on the Drug Task Force tip line.
